I’m For Alan ,Peter Amewu Shakes NPP With His “Alan Endorsement”

In a surprising turn of events, former Energy Minister John Peter Amewu has endorsed Alan Kyrematen for the New Patriotic Party’s (NPP) presidential nomination.

Peter Amewu, the incumbent Minister of Railways, voiced his support for Alan Kyerematen’s presidential ambitions in his presence.

During his speech, Amewu revealed that during the previous presidential election, despite Kyerematen being his Godfather, he refused to cooperate with him and instead voted for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o.

“When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o stood for president in 2016, we NPP members in the Volta Region were confident that he would win… As most of you are aware, Alan is my godfather, and he asked me to work with him at the time. I told him, “Alan, I am unable to work for you because you must consider what is best for Ghana at the present time.”

Amewu continued by highlighting the significance of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o’s 2016 leadership in Ghana, not only for the NPP but for the entire country. He stated, “…What was best at the time was not just for the NPP, but the entire nation of Ghana demanded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o as their leader in 2016.”

The railway development minister further expressed his support for Alan Kyerematen by stating, “In Ghana today, it is not just the NPP party that is solidly behind Alan Kyerematen, but the entire country.”

The former Energy Minister’s support carries significant weight within the NPP
